Fox's lone Cinema Archive announcement this week is 1961's The Silent Call. New to DVD and available at ClassicFlix on October 27th, the drama stars Gail Russell and David McLean. This release adds to the total of over 300 Cinema Archive titles exclusively available for rent at ClassicFlix.com.

Read moreOlive Films has announced a November 24th release date for the DVD and Blu-Ray debut of the 1949 drama The Kid From Cleveland starring Russ Tamblyn in his first film. Also arriving on the same day is the 1944 horro film, Voodoo Man, starring Bela Lugosi, making its debut on Blu-ray. Bonus features to the DVD and Blu-Ray aren't anticipated.
